History and Key Milestones
Belatra was founded in 1993 by an engineer inspired by the glitz of Las Vegas. They spent years focused on manufacturing gaming machines and software for land-based casinos before online gaming even crossed their radar.
As online casinos took off, Belatra pivoted and started building online slots that work on any device. Their three-decade track record is rare in this industry and gives them an edge over many newer competitors.
Reputation in the Industry
Belatra’s picked up multiple industry awards and nominations. Their game Make It Gold nabbed Most Played Game, and Mummyland Treasures got a nod for Best Slot Design. They even won the Player’s Pick for Best Slot Provider, which says a lot about how players feel.
The company’s been nominated at major gaming events like SiGMA Americas and SBC Europe. Blast the Bass stood out for both design and soundtrack. I’ve seen their games pop up in award lists year after year, which tells me they’re doing something right.

Use of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
Belatra runs all their games on certified RNG systems. Each spin result is totally independent, so you can’t predict or influence what comes next.
The RNG spits out thousands of number sequences every second. When you hit spin, the game grabs the current number and that’s what determines your symbols—long before the reels even stop.
Third-party labs have tested Belatra’s RNGs, and in my experience, the results are as random as they come. You get the same unpredictability whether you’re playing high-variance slots or something more relaxed.
Licensing and Compliance
Belatra Games operates with certifications from several respected test labs instead of holding traditional gaming licenses. They’ve got approvals from GLI, BMM Test Labs, TriSigma, and SiQ Gaming Laboratories—these groups check for fair play and game integrity across the board.

Belatra relies on these test lab certifications, not direct gaming authority licenses. This setup lets their games appear at casinos that hold the actual jurisdictional licenses. So, the casino operator is the one on the hook for regulatory compliance, not Belatra itself.
Certifications and Fair Gaming Audits
GLI, BMM, TriSigma, and SiQ all audit Belatra’s games for random outcomes and accurate RTPs. These certifications make sure nobody can mess with the results and that the RTPs listed are the real deal. TriSigma and SiQ, in particular, dig deep into how the RNGs work.
BMM Test Labs checks for technical standards, so you’re not just getting a fair game—you’re getting one that actually works. I’ve noticed RTPs usually hover between 96% and 97%, which is solid for most slots out there.
Jurisdiction-Specific Approvals
This certification model lets Belatra’s games show up at casinos in lots of countries, even if Belatra doesn’t have a license for each market. The casino itself needs to be licensed in its region, though. I always recommend double-checking a casino’s licensing info before you play—don’t just take their word for it.
Game availability can shift depending on where you live, since it’s tied to the casino’s regulatory status. You might not see every Belatra game in every country, but the fairness stays the same thanks to those test lab audits. Local laws decide what you can access, not the provider.
